The Challenge
The Japanese customer was looking for a high-performance solution for the continuous cutting of extremely tough steels, with the ability to maintain tight tolerances, ensure high productivity, and keep the cost per cut as low as possible. The real challenge, however, was related to space constraints inside the facility: they needed a single machine capable of replacing the productivity of three traditional cutting systems, within a compact footprint, and with reliable multi-shift performance. The machine had to be robust, precise, and automated, allowing for easy and safe loading/unloading, and meeting the highest operational safety standards—ideal for a high-volume, high intensity production environment.
The Solution
Friggi supplied the ONL HSS bandsaw, engineered in every detail to set a new benchmark in high-speed cutting of tool and alloy steels.
Key features:
Heavy-duty frame and oversized components for industrial-grade operations
Carbide blade for high-speed cutting with long life
Linear and constant head feeding system with brushless motors and ball screws, ensuring maximum precision
Material clamping system controlled by encoders, offering robust and accurate locking
No vibration or noise during cutting
Extended blade life thanks to smooth, controlled dynamics
Safe and efficient material loading and unloading
Industry 4.0 ready, enabling remote monitoring and control
